**Te whiwhinga mahi | The opportunity**

Develop your career providing expert air quality assessments and advice to support significant infrastructure, industrial and community projects. You will be part of a tight knit team of trusted advisors, scientists, and environmental specialists shaping environmental outcomes across a diverse variety of projects.

In this role, you will:

- Bring your existing knowledge and technical expertise to the Beca Air Quality team
- Undertake air quality assessments to support a wide range of clients
- Undertake air quality dispersion modelling assessments
- Manage projects from their inception to completion
- Build great relationships with internal and external clients
- Uphold and promote the Beca key values of partnership, tenacity, enjoyment, and care

As part of the Environmental & Sustainability Advisory practice, you will be part of a team of over 60 environmental scientists and sustainability advisors located throughout New Zealand. Together, you will be working with a team who are committed and focused on shaping environmental and sustainability outcomes.

**Ko wai koe | About you**

This is a broad role where ideally your background will include:

- Critical thinking and strong problem-solving skills
- Experience in a consultancy environment (preferably 5+ experience)
- Experience in undertaking air quality assessments
- A good understanding of New Zealand’s air quality legislative and planning framework
- Experience with the use of atmospheric dispersion models such as AERMOD, CALPUFF,TAPM and WRF would be an advantage
- Proven ability in data analysis and interpretation
- Experience in developing air quality management plans
- Strong communication and writing skills
- A bachelor degrees or higher in engineering, a physical science discipline, or environmental science; and
- Being a Certified Air Quality Professional (CAQP), or having a similar professional body certification, would be an advantage.
